> Bonjour Laurent,
Salut Marc,
En éditant les fichiers serveur.xml ou encore web.xml, je souhaitais
réaliser un pool de connexion.
Mais peut importe pour l'instant :
j'ai créé une Jsp simple pour tester mon driver JDBC-MySQL.
Le driver fonctionne (je l'ai testé avec une mini appli Java).
En revanche, les droits de connexion sous Tomcat ne semblent pas bons,
malgré ma config. dans le fichier catalina.policy :
- ------------------------------------------------------------------
//The permission granted to your JDBC driver
grant codeBase
"file:${catalina.home}/common/lib/mysql-connector-java-3.0.17-ga-bin.jar" {
permission java.net.SocketPermission "localhost:3306", "connect";
};
// The permissions granted to the context apply to JSP pages
grant codeBase "file:${catalina.home}/webapps/TutoJSPJdbc/jsp/-" {
permission java.net.SocketPermission "localhost:3306", "connect";
permission java.net.SocketPermission "localhost:8080", "connect";
};
// The permissions granted to the context WEB-INF/classes directory
grant codeBase
"file:${catalina.home}/webapps/TutoJSPJdbc/WEB-INF/classes/-" {
permission java.net.SocketPermission "localhost:3306", "connect";
};
- ------------------------------------------------------------------------
Sais tu si cette configuration de catalina.policy est correcte (et
suffisante) ?
Je ne suis pas sur, mais je crois que pour pouvoir mettre des droits,
ilf aut plutot utiliser des URL web plutot que fichier non? car quand
tuonnavigateur arrive ce n'est pas des ficheirs qu'il demande mais des
url et du coup la comparaison des deux ne marche pas car l'un est en
local (file) et non en distant.
laurent
____________________________________________________
Want to buy your Pack or Services from Mandriva?
Go to http://store.mandriva.com
Join the Club : http://www.mandrivaclub.com
____________________________________________________